Nanotechnology, the science of manipulating matter at the atomic and molecular levels, has found its way into the world of sports in Kazakhstan. This innovative technology is revolutionizing the way athletes train, compete, and recover, offering numerous benefits that can give them a competitive edge. In Kazakhstan, the integration of nanotechnology in sports has become a game-changer. From equipment design to performance enhancement and injury prevention, nanotechnology is making a significant impact on the sporting scene in the country. One of the key areas where nanotechnology is being employed in sports is in the development of sports equipment. Nanomaterials such as carbon nanotubes and graphene are being used to create lighter, stronger, and more durable equipment, such as tennis rackets, golf clubs, and bicycles. These nanomaterials offer superior strength-to-weight ratios, increased flexibility, and improved performance, giving athletes the tools they need to excel in their respective sports. Moreover, nanotechnology is being used to enhance athletic performance and recovery. Nanoparticles embedded in sportswear fabrics can help regulate body temperature, improve moisture management, and reduce friction, leading to increased comfort and performance for athletes. Nanoparticle-infused supplements and energy drinks are also being developed to improve endurance, strength, and recovery, helping athletes push their limits and recover faster after intense training sessions or competitions. In addition, nanotechnology is playing a significant role in injury prevention and rehabilitation in sports. Nanomaterials are being used to develop innovative protective gear, such as helmets and padding, that provide better impact absorption and protection against injuries. Nanoparticle-based therapies are also being explored for their potential in enhancing tissue regeneration and accelerating the healing process, helping athletes recover from injuries faster and get back to training and competing sooner.
